HR technology startup Darwinbox announced on Wednesday the closing of a $140 million funding round. This investment was co-led by prominent private equity firms Partners Group and KKR, with additional participation from Gravity Holdings.
Launched in 2015, Darwinbox focuses on AI-backed HR management, providing its services with a mobile-first approach. The company’s cloud-based Human Capital Management (HCM) software is designed to manage the full employee lifecycle, catering to a wide range of HR needs for enterprises.
Darwinbox is currently supported by a group of global investors representing high levels in the industry, including TCV, Microsoft, Salesforce Ventures, Peak XV, Lightspeed, and Endiya Partners.
